Factors to Consider When Choosing a Mental Health Therapist in Cleveland

Searching for therapists in Cleveland starts with knowing what kind of support you want and which therapist experience matches your needs. Cleveland therapists may list specialties such as anxiety, depression, grief, relationship challenges, trauma, or life transitions. As you compare options, look for a therapist whose training, listed specialties, and approach align with what you want to address. Provider bios can also help you understand whether a therapist uses approaches like cognitive behavioral therapy, dialectical behavior therapy, trauma-informed care, or couples counseling.

Cleveland offers a broad range of therapy options across neighborhoods and nearby communities, from downtown and Ohio City to Lakewood, Tremont, and surrounding areas. Your best fit may depend on more than location. Consider whether you prefer in-person sessions near work or home, or virtual therapy that fits more easily around your schedule. You can also narrow your search by appointment availability, whether a therapist is accepting new patients, session format, and whether a free phone consultation is offered. Reading profiles before booking can help you compare communication style, care approach, and what to expect in a first session.

If you're experiencing or worried about violence, threats, or coercion in your relationship, couples therapy isn't usually the right starting point — individual support is safer. The National Domestic Violence Hotline (1-800-799-7233, or text START to 88788\) can help you think through next steps.
